累量域波达方向估计的稳健性

摘    要:本文提出了一种用于等距线阵的四阶累量域波达方向(DOA)估计算法,并着重研究了算法的稳健性(Robustness).该算法利用了空间累量阵中的所有非冗余累量元素,并将相位相同的累量元素做平滑处理,Toeplitz化后形成新的虚拟协方差矩阵,方向估计基于此阵.分析表明,该算法对阵列误差有较强的容差性,加之累量对高斯噪声的自然盲性,因而算法具有稳健性.该算法的另一个特点是可以提供虚拟扩展孔径(扩展近两倍),从而提高了算法的估计性能和分辨能力.仿真实验验证了分析结果,表明了算法良好的性能.

Robustness of DoA Estimation in Cumulant Domain
Abstract:A robust Dirction-of- Arrival(DOA) estimation algorithm for uniform linear arrayin fourth-order cumulants domain is presented. Emphasis is laid on the investigation of robustnessof the algorithm. The algorithm is based on the Toeplitz Approximation Method (TAM) applied tovirtual correlation elements provided by the spatial fourth-order cumulants. Analytical resultshows that the algorithm is tolerant to array uncertainties and insensitive to additive Gaussiannoise. The algorithm is also featured with virtual aperture extention (nearly twice the actual aperture ) so that the resolvability can be enhanced. Simulation experiments are included to validate theanalytical result and to illustrate the robustness of the algorithm.
